About Anthony Ananga
Anthony Ananga is a scholar working on Biochemistry, Insect Science and Plant Science, having authored 15 papers that have together received 485 indexed citations. Recurring topics across this work include Plant Gene Expression Analysis (5 papers), Horticultural and Viticultural Research (4 papers) and Phytochemicals and Antioxidant Activities (3 papers). The work is most often cited by research in Biochemistry (203 citations), Food Science (162 citations) and Drug Discovery (1 citation). Anthony Ananga has collaborated with scholars based in United States, Kenya and Bulgaria. Frequent co-authors include Violeta Tsolova, Vasil Georgiev, Ernst Cebert, Joel W. Ochieng, Koffi Konan, Ramesh V. Kantety, K. M. Soliman, Ivayla Dincheva, Velizar Gochev and Ilian Badjakov. Their work appears in journals such as Molecules, Nutrients and Current Pharmaceutical Design.
